Understanding Aryaka MPLS Limitations in Modern Networks
While Aryaka’s dedicated MPLS offering provides a robust and reliable foundation for many businesses, it’s crucial to understand certain constraints in today's increasingly dynamic and demanding network ecosystems. The traditional MPLS framework, though stable, can sometimes struggle with the agility needed to fully support cloud-centric workloads and modern remote offices. Specifically, changes to network connectivity can experience latency due to the inherent complexities of the copyright network, potentially impacting real-time throughput. Furthermore, the static nature of MPLS circuits can lead to sub-optimal resource distribution when compared to more flexible Software-Defined Wide Area Network (SD-WAN) alternatives. Businesses should carefully consider these factors to ensure Aryaka MPLS continues to fulfill their evolving network needs and long-term goals. Ultimately, a thorough investigation of Aryaka's MPLS capabilities alongside other emerging technologies is suggested for optimal network performance.
SASE for Production: Addressing Business-Unique Challenges
The changing landscape of contemporary manufacturing demands a significantly new approach to network safeguarding and access. Traditional perimeter-based models simply fail to adequately secure against the consistently sophisticated threats targeting operational technology (OT) environments. SASE offers a hopeful solution by converging network and security functions into a single, cloud-delivered service. However, implementing SASE in a production setting requires careful assessment of the unique challenges. These include the need for granular access control based on user roles and asset criticality, minimal-delay connectivity for real-time device operations, and seamless integration with legacy OT infrastructure. Furthermore, resolving compliance requirements related to information sovereignty and industrial standards is critical for a positive SASE implementation.
